Dental Implants vs. Dentures: What You Need to Know
Understanding the differences between dental implants and dentures is essential; each option has benefits and drawbacks. Fortunately, when you choose Desai Dental Care, we can walk you through the details so you can decide what’s right for you.
Here are some of the pros and cons of each option:
Dental Implants
Although dental implants require a longer time commitment and can be more expensive, there are numerous benefits to consider:
- They look and feel like real teeth, giving you the aesthetic beauty you want.
- They are a permanent tooth replacement solution, capable of lasting a lifetime.
- They stimulate your jawbone, keeping it from deteriorating and helping maintain your facial structure.
- They don’t slip or shift in your mouth, eliminating embarrassing moments.
- They are easy to care for, requiring the same treatment as natural teeth.
Dentures
Although dentures may require more cleaning time, require periodic adjustments and replacement, don’t prevent jawbone deterioration, and can shift when eating or speaking, there are benefits to consider:
- They are a non-surgical tooth replacement option, helping you avoid a more extensive procedure.
- They are often a more affordable option, making it possible to replace all your teeth within a budget.
- They can quickly replace your upper and lower arch, making them practical for anyone with complete tooth loss.
